Common Questions

What permits and licenses are needed to regrade my quarter-acre lot?

Significant earth-moving on a 0.25-acre parcel typically requires an engineered grading plan and a permit from the Martin County Building Department. This work must be performed by a contractor licensed by the Florida Department of Business and Professional Regulation, as improper grading can affect drainage for multiple properties and violate county codes.

How can I keep my Floratam St. Augustine green with only two watering days a week?

Year-round conservation rules require precise irrigation management. A Wi-Fi smart controller paired with in-ground soil moisture sensors creates an ET-based schedule, applying water only when the root zone needs it. This technology maximizes infiltration during allowed windows, preserving turf health while staying well within municipal water budgets.

What are the biggest weed threats here, and how do I deal with them during the summer?

Vinca major and lantana are persistent invasive species that compete with natives. Treatment requires targeted manual removal or careful herbicide application. Crucially, Florida's fertilizer blackout from June 1 to September 30 prohibits nitrogen applications, so weed control during this period must rely on non-nutritive cultural and mechanical methods.

I'm tired of weekly mowing and blowing. Are there lower-maintenance options?

Transitioning high-input turf areas to a landscape of Saw Palmetto, Beautyberry, and Dune Sunflower drastically reduces mowing and eliminates gas-powered blowing. This native palette is adapted to our sandy soil and rainfall patterns, conserving water and aligning with evolving noise ordinances that restrict loud maintenance equipment.

Are permeable pavers a better choice than wood decking for a new patio?

For longevity and fire safety, permeable concrete pavers are superior. They do not rot, warp, or attract termites like wood, and their non-combustible nature contributes to defensible space in Jensen Beach's Moderate (WUI Zone 2) fire rating. Their durability and permeability also offer better long-term value and drainage performance.

My lawn seems to struggle no matter what I do. Is it the soil?

Properties in Jensen Beach Club, built around 1982, have soil over 40 years old. Sandy Spodosols are naturally acidic and nutrient-poor, with a hardpan layer that restricts root growth. This mature soil profile requires annual core aeration to improve percolation and a regimen of organic amendments, like composted manure, to build a viable rhizosphere for St. Augustine turf.

My yard pools water for days after heavy rain. What's the solution?

The high water table and sandy, compacted subsoil common here lead to seasonal localized flooding. A French drain system tied to a dry well is often necessary. For new patios or walkways, specifying permeable concrete pavers increases surface infiltration, helping projects meet Martin County Building Department runoff standards.
